java.lang.Object
org.apache.pulsar.common.policies.data.NamespaceIsolationDataImpl.NamespaceIsolationDataImplBuilder
All Implemented Interfaces:
org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der
Enclosing class:
NamespaceIsolationDataImpl
public static class NamespaceIsolationDataImpl.NamespaceIsolationDataImplBuilder
extends Object
implements org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der
Constructor Summary
Constructors
Method Summary
All Methods Instance Methods Concrete Methods
autoFailoverPolicy (org.apache.pulsar.common.policies.data.AutoFailoverPolicyData autoFailoverPolicy)
Methods inherited from class java.lang.Object
clone , equals , finalize , getClass , hashCode , notify , notifyAll , toString , wait , wait , wait
Constructor Details
NamespaceIsolationDataImplBuilder
public NamespaceIsolationDataImplBuilder ()
Method Details
namespaces
Specified by:
namespaces in interface org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der
primary
Specified by:
primary in interface org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der
secondary
Specified by:
secondary in interface org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der
autoFailoverPolicy
Specified by:
autoFailoverPolicy in interface org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der
build
Specified by:
build in interface org.apache.pulsar.common.policies.data.NamespaceIsolationData.Builder